ASGSA

Animal Science Graduate Student Association

To foster close relationship among Animal Science graduate students and faculty among all disciplines of Animal Science at the Texas A&M University; to encourage leadership; to promote greater interest in the profession; and to promote participation in professional activities.

Horsemen's

Texas A&M Horsemen's Association

The purpose of this organization shall be to provide a social and educational environment for those students sharing a common interest in the equine industry while promoting leadership through organizational activities and offering networking opportunities.
